Ticket #4412 — Docs vault locked after role migration

During review of the Quillmark wiki role-based access change, the admin vault auto-locked when the legacy "curator" role was dropped. Editors migrated cleanly, but vault unlock now requires the new "steward" role plus the stored recovery credential. Reviewer: please verify the role-mapping diff doesn't strip steward from service accounts before merge. To reopen the vault for testing, use the recovery passphrase below.

unlock words, fafop-hawep: briwyn-oliix-sorox

// REINDEX_BATCH_CAP limits docs per shard pass in the Tallowfield
// nightly search reindex. Raising it starves the ingest queue;
// lowering it overruns the maintenance window. 5000 is the tested
// sweet spot. Change only with a soak run. Verified against the
// build noted below.

session token of bawif-hahog = htk6_ac5981

INTERNAL MEMO — Board of Directors

We have completed preliminary diligence on a potential acquisition of Tessmark Instruments, a regional maker of calibration equipment. Early findings indicate a defensible niche, modest debt, and a management team open to retention agreements. Valuation discussions remain informal; no term sheet has been exchanged. Outside counsel at the Harwyn firm has been engaged for a deeper legal review. Given the sensitivity, the following note on our intentions is strictly board-confidential.

board note of kageg-bahof: The renewal with Holwynax Holdings closes at $2 million a year, 5 percent below the last contract. Project Ulaath slips by two quarters because of the supplier delay.